Formation of Harmful Compounds
When meat, poultry, or fish are cooked at high temperatures, especially over an open flame, several types of potentially harmful compounds can form. These arise from the interaction of heat with proteins and fats in the food, and the combustion of the fuel source.
Heterocyclic Amines (HCAs)
HCAs are a group of chemicals formed when the amino acids, sugars, and creatine in muscle meat react at high temperatures. Grilling, broiling, and pan-frying all create HCAs, but the intense, direct heat of grilling is a significant contributor. The higher the cooking temperature and the longer the cooking time, the more HCAs are produced. HCAs have been shown in animal studies to be mutagenic, meaning they can cause changes in DNA, and are considered potential carcinogens. While the direct link between HCA consumption and cancer in humans is still being researched, many health organizations advise limiting exposure. This is particularly concerning when charring occurs, as charred areas contain the highest concentrations of HCAs.
Polycyclic Aromatic Hydrocarbons (PAHs)
PAHs are a group of chemicals formed when fat and juices from meat drip onto the hot grill, causing flare-ups. The smoke produced from these burning drippings then coats the food, introducing PAHs. Similar to HCAs, PAHs have been identified as potential carcinogens in animal studies. Some PAHs are also mutagenic. The darker the char on the food, the higher the likelihood of PAH contamination. This is why burnt or heavily blackened food is often advised against for health reasons.
The Impact of Marinades and Seasonings
While marinades can add flavor and tenderness, some ingredients commonly found in grilling marinades can actually exacerbate the formation of HCAs and PAHs. For instance, marinades containing sugar can caramelize quickly, leading to charring and increased compound formation. Conversely, certain marinade ingredients, like acidic components (vinegar, lemon juice) and antioxidants (found in herbs like rosemary and thyme), have been shown to reduce the formation of these harmful compounds. This highlights a nuance: the composition of your marinade can influence the health profile of your grilled food.
Nutrient Loss and Alteration
While grilling can preserve some nutrients, the high heat and direct exposure to flame can also lead to a loss or alteration of certain beneficial compounds in food.
Vitamin Degradation
Water-soluble vitamins, such as B vitamins and vitamin C, are particularly susceptible to degradation when exposed to high heat and prolonged cooking times. While grilling is often a relatively quick cooking method, the intense heat can still contribute to the loss of these essential nutrients. Fat-soluble vitamins (A, D, E, K) are generally more stable, but some loss can still occur.
Oxidation of Fats
The high temperatures involved in grilling can lead to the oxidation of fats, particularly unsaturated fats. This process can reduce the nutritional value of the fat and potentially create undesirable compounds. While some oxidation is natural during cooking, excessive heat can accelerate it.
Practical and Logistical Challenges
Beyond health concerns, grilling presents a range of practical and logistical challenges that can make it less appealing or feasible for certain individuals or situations.
Time and Preparation Demands
Grilling is not always a quick, spontaneous cooking method. There’s a significant investment of time and effort involved before you even start cooking.
Fueling and Preheating
Whether you’re using charcoal or gas, there’s a waiting period involved. Charcoal needs to be lit and allowed to ash over, which can take 20-30 minutes or more. Gas grills require preheating to reach the optimal cooking temperature, typically 10-15 minutes. This preheating time is crucial for even cooking and to prevent food from sticking.
Marinating and Preparation
Many grilled dishes benefit from marinating, which can require several hours or even overnight. Beyond marinating, the preparation of food for the grill – cutting, skewering, seasoning – adds to the overall time commitment.
Ongoing Monitoring and Flipping
Grilling requires constant attention. Food needs to be turned, moved, and monitored to prevent burning or undercooking. This isn’t a “set it and forget it” cooking method. The intense heat means that a moment of inattention can lead to a ruined meal.
Weather Dependency
This is a fundamental and often frustrating limitation of outdoor grilling. The joy of a summer barbecue can be quickly dampened by a sudden downpour, high winds, or freezing temperatures. This makes grilling an unreliable option for planned meals when weather is unpredictable. For those who rely on grilling as their primary cooking method, inclement weather can necessitate last-minute meal plan changes or resorting to indoor cooking.
Mess and Cleanup
Grilling, by its nature, is a messy endeavor.
Grease and Splatter
As fat drips from the food, it can splatter and create a greasy film on the grill, surrounding surfaces, and even on the cook themselves. This can make the cooking area a hazard and require thorough cleaning.
Stubborn Residue
Burnt-on food particles and grease can be notoriously difficult to remove from grill grates. This often requires vigorous scrubbing with specialized brushes and cleaning agents. Leaving the grill dirty can lead to flare-ups and affect the flavor of future meals.
The Grill Itself
The grill itself needs regular cleaning and maintenance. Charcoal ash needs to be disposed of, and the exterior of both charcoal and gas grills can accumulate grease and dirt.
Limited Cooking Versatility
While grilling excels at certain types of cooking, its versatility is somewhat limited compared to other methods like baking, roasting, or stovetop cooking.
Delicate Foods and Small Items
Extremely delicate foods, such as thinly sliced fish or small vegetables, can easily fall through the grill grates, leading to waste. While grill baskets and foil packets can mitigate this, they can also alter the direct grilling experience and flavor.
Sauces and Delicate Liquids
Adding delicate sauces too early in the grilling process can cause them to burn. Holding sauces until the end or finishing them indoors is often necessary, which can be an inconvenience.
Baking and Steaming
Grilling is not suitable for baking or steaming in the traditional sense. While some “grill baking” techniques exist, they often involve specialized equipment and do not replicate the results of a conventional oven.
Cost of Equipment and Fuel
The initial investment in a grill can be substantial, ranging from a few hundred dollars for a basic model to thousands for high-end, feature-rich units. Beyond the grill itself, there are ongoing costs associated with fuel.
Charcoal vs. Gas
Charcoal briquettes or lump charcoal represent a recurring expense. For gas grills, propane tank refills or natural gas line connections are necessary. The cost of fuel can add up over time, especially for frequent grillers.
Accessories
To enhance the grilling experience, many accessories are purchased, such as grill tools, thermometers, cleaning brushes, grill covers, and even smokers. These add to the overall financial outlay.
Environmental Considerations
The environmental impact of grilling, while often overlooked, is a growing concern for many.
Air Pollution and Emissions
The burning of charcoal or propane releases particulate matter and other air pollutants into the atmosphere. This contributes to local air quality issues and can have broader environmental consequences. In densely populated areas, frequent grilling can even contribute to a noticeable haze.
Resource Consumption
Charcoal production, in particular, can be associated with deforestation if not sourced sustainably. The manufacturing of grills themselves also consumes resources and energy.
Waste Generation
Disposable charcoal grills and aluminum foil packets used for grilling can contribute to landfill waste if not properly recycled or disposed of.

Does grilling contribute to food safety concerns?
Yes, grilling can contribute to food safety concerns if not handled correctly. The high temperatures used in grilling can create a misleading appearance of cooked food. A nicely browned exterior does not always guarantee that the interior has reached a safe internal temperature, potentially leaving harmful bacteria like Salmonella or E. coli alive.
Proper food handling before and during grilling is crucial. This includes preventing cross-contamination between raw and cooked foods, ensuring meats are thawed properly, and using a food thermometer to verify that food has reached its safe internal temperature. Neglecting these steps can lead to foodborne illnesses.

How can the disadvantages of grilling be mitigated?
While the disadvantages of grilling are present, they can be significantly mitigated with conscious effort and technique. To reduce the formation of HCAs and PAHs, avoid charring food, flip meats frequently, and trim excess fat before grilling. Marinating meats in acidic marinades or using herbs like rosemary has also shown potential in reducing these compounds.
Furthermore, consider grilling at lower temperatures or using indirect heat methods. Opting for leaner cuts of meat and incorporating plenty of vegetables into your grilling repertoire can also be beneficial. Choosing gas grills over charcoal can reduce some of the environmental impact and improve air quality, and adopting a mindset of mindful grilling can help minimize the risks while still enjoying the experience.
